Shaping calixarene frameworks. Synthesis and structure of a calix[8]arene containing three bridging phosphate units

Abstract:The reaction of p-tert-butylcalix8]arene with PCl5, followed by hydrolysis and subsequent esterification with triethyl orthoformate afforded a triphosphate involving all phenolic oxygen atoms of the calixarene framework. As revealed by an X-ray diffraction study, the presence of two μ3-(O,O,O) and one μ2-(O,O) bridging phosphoryl groups results in an unusual lengthening of the calix8]arene loop (longest Ocdots, three dots, centeredO separation: 13.9 Å)
